Kathrine Kleveland (born 7 April 1966) is a Norwegian politician for the Centre Party.
Kleveland was born on 7 April 1966 to farmer and carpenter Jakob Rønningen and Ellen-Marie Wallumrød.
[2] She was elected representative to the Storting from the constituency of Vestfold for the period 2021–2025, for the Centre Party.
In the Storting, she was a member of the Standing Committee on Local Government and Public Administration from 2021 to 2025.
